Shamrocks fall just short in home opener after major first-half comeback
YUMA, Ariz. (KYMA, KECY) - The Yuma Catholic Rocks finally hit the floor for their long-awaited home opener Tuesday night, hosting the Seton Catholic Sentinels a team looking to improve to 2–0 on the young season. After last week’s scheduled opener was canceled, YC was eager to put on a show for the home crowd. Seton Catholic struck first and fast.
